The Supreme Court in the case of ELEGUSHI V OSENI (2005) 14 NWLR (PT 945) AT 348 aptly stated the five types of legal land ownership in Nigeria and they are as follows: 1, By traditional evidence. 2. By acts of Ownership extending over a sufficient length of time which acts are numerous and positive enough to warrant the inference that they are owners 3. Differences between Right of Occupancy (R of O) and Certificate of Occupancy (C of O)

Image
 Right of occupancy (R Of O) is just an offer while a (C Of O) certificate of occupancy is certified right of your ownership of the said land.  R of O is a weaker title to land and vulnerable while C of O is a superior title and secured.  R of O could be revoked without compensation while C of O is compensated for. Hence, it's very important to perfect your land title to C of O after an offer of R of O is given to you. That's why most land buyers are very concerned on the title as a C of O always attracts a higher value.  When given an offer of R of O, a premium sum is attached to the offer to be paid for perfection to C of O.
